建立数据库一般都用什么语言
-
建立数据库一般使用的语言有以下几种:
-
SQL(结构化查询语言):SQL是最常用的数据库语言,用于管理关系数据库系统。通过使用SQL,可以创建、修改和查询数据库中的表和数据。
-
Python:Python是一种通用的编程语言,它提供了多个数据库接口和库,如Python DB-API、SQLAlchemy和Django ORM等。Python可以用于连接和操作各种类型的数据库,包括关系型数据库(如MySQL、PostgreSQL)和非关系型数据库(如MongoDB、Redis)。
-
Java:Java是一种广泛应用于企业级应用开发的编程语言。Java提供了多个数据库连接接口和库,如JDBC(Java数据库连接)和Hibernate等。通过Java,可以连接和操作各种类型的数据库。
-
PHP:PHP是一种用于开发Web应用的脚本语言,特别适用于与数据库进行交互。PHP提供了多个数据库扩展和库,如MySQLi和PDO等。PHP可以用于连接和操作各种类型的数据库。
-
C#:C#是微软开发的一种面向对象的编程语言,用于开发Windows应用程序和Web应用程序。C#提供了多个数据库连接接口和库,如ADO.NET和Entity Framework等。通过C#,可以连接和操作各种类型的数据库。
这些语言都具有各自的优缺点和适用场景,选择建立数据库时需要根据具体需求和开发环境来决定使用哪种语言。
1年前 -
-
建立数据库一般使用的语言有多种,根据具体的需求和技术背景可以选择不同的语言。以下是一些常用的语言:
-
SQL(Structured Query Language):SQL是数据库领域最常用的语言,用于管理和操作关系型数据库。SQL语言可以用来创建数据库、表格、插入、更新和删除数据等操作。
-
Python:Python是一种通用的编程语言,也可以用于数据库开发。Python提供了多个库和框架,如SQLAlchemy和Django,可以帮助开发人员进行数据库连接和操作。
-
Java:Java是一种广泛使用的编程语言,也可以用于数据库开发。Java提供了多个类库和框架,如JDBC和Hibernate,可以用于连接和操作数据库。
-
C#:C#是微软开发的一种面向对象的编程语言,也可以用于数据库开发。C#提供了多个类库和框架,如ADO.NET和Entity Framework,可以用于连接和操作数据库。
-
PHP:PHP是一种广泛用于Web开发的脚本语言,也可以用于数据库开发。PHP提供了多个函数和扩展,如MySQLi和PDO,可以用于连接和操作数据库。
除了上述语言外,还有其他语言如Ruby、Perl和Go等也可以用于数据库开发。选择哪种语言主要取决于个人或团队的技术背景、项目需求和个人偏好。
1年前 -
-
建立数据库一般使用的语言主要有SQL(Structured Query Language)和NoSQL(Not Only SQL)。
-
SQL:SQL是一种用于管理关系型数据库的语言。关系型数据库使用表格来组织和存储数据,通过使用SQL语句来查询、插入、更新和删除数据。SQL具有以下特点:
- 结构化:数据以表格的形式存储,每个表格包含行和列。
- 基于模式:在创建表格之前需要定义表格的结构(列名、数据类型等)。
- 支持事务:SQL支持事务的概念,可以保证数据的一致性和完整性。
- 强大的查询功能:SQL提供了丰富的查询语法,可以对数据进行复杂的过滤和排序。
-
NoSQL:NoSQL是一种非关系型数据库,用于存储非结构化和半结构化的数据。NoSQL数据库的设计目标是为了满足大规模数据的高性能和可扩展性需求。NoSQL数据库具有以下特点:
- 非结构化:NoSQL数据库可以存储任意类型的数据,不需要事先定义表格的结构。
- 高性能:NoSQL数据库采用了各种优化技术,以提供高并发和低延迟的数据读写能力。
- 可扩展:NoSQL数据库可以水平扩展,通过增加服务器节点来提高处理能力。
- 高可用性:NoSQL数据库支持数据的冗余存储和自动故障恢复,以保证数据的可用性。
总结:
建立数据库一般使用SQL和NoSQL两种语言。SQL适用于关系型数据库,具有结构化、基于模式、事务支持和强大的查询功能等特点;NoSQL适用于非关系型数据库,具有非结构化、高性能、可扩展和高可用性等特点。选择使用哪种语言要根据具体需求和应用场景来决定。1年前 -